Welding, a crucial part of modern industry, continues to evolve with technological advancements influencing both technique and efficiency.

In the early days, welding involved simple processes that primarily relied on heat and pressure to join metals. These methods were labor-intensive and required significant manual skill. However, the advent of technology has revolutionized the welding industry, particularly here at Stratton Welding Service, where we continuously adopt advanced technologies to improve quality and precision.

One of the most significant technological advancements in welding is the introduction of automated welding systems. Automation reduces human error and increases the speed and consistency of welds. Automated systems are especially beneficial for large-scale projects that demand uniform quality across multiple welds. The evolution of welding technology also includes the use of advanced materials. Newer welding techniques such as laser welding and electron beam welding are designed to work with lightweight and high-strength materials. These methods are highly efficient and significantly reduce the risk of structural weakness. Another exciting development in the welding industry is the use of virtual reality (VR) training for welders. VR technology provides a risk-free environment where new welders can learn and practice their skills. This innovative approach helps reduce training costs and improves the learning curve for new technicians.
